逆向工程vxworks(替換較新路由器上的Linux)

Linksys路由器看到的是WRT54G版本1.它是著名的運行Linux,並且是在鼎盛時期返回的源頭,導致流行的替代固件包作為DD-WRT和番茄。但是該公司從硬件版本8開始地遠離基於Linux的固件。現在他們正在使用稱為VxWorks的專有實時操作系統。

[Craig]最近將WRT54GV8和更新路由器的逆向工程指南放在一起。他的方法是純粹的固件,因為他實際上並不是自己運行VxWorks的路由器。在十六進制轉儲中有點戳了一下,讓他識別文件的不同部分,導致精靈標題,真正開始解鎖內部的秘密。從那裡,他執行一個相當漫長的過程,準確地將代碼拆卸成有意義的東西。用於此選擇的選擇工具是IDA Pro DiaSsembler和調試器。我們以前沒有熟悉它,但看到它可以做些什麼我們印象深刻。

[通過Wikimedia Commons]

Leave a Reply

Your email address will not be published. Required fields are marked *